How they compare
Niger currently reports 1.62 million against 1.49 million in Italy, a difference of 128,700.
That makes Niger's figure about 1.1 times Italy's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Italy ahead.
Italy ranks 44th and Niger ranks 42nd of 217 countries.
Italy has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Italy | Niger |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 2.01 million | 208,684 | 1.80 million | Italy |
| 1970s | 2.07 million | 291,744 | 1.77 million | Italy |
| 1980s | 2.33 million | 376,852 | 1.95 million | Italy |
| 1990s | 1.89 million | 510,118 | 1.38 million | Italy |
| 2000s | 1.50 million | 696,112 | 800,765 | Italy |
| 2010s | 1.48 million | 1.05 million | 430,488 | Italy |
| 2020s | 1.48 million | 1.48 million | 1,100 | Italy |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
